Output 50e4784cec3601941905432a4d00e68b5d7dfce8e00321575ea40c87b8360caf:0

value
100654709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 137471c1961b8a6f6751dcd723034d014288a8f0 OP_EQUAL
address
33TtFtFkwwnC9XrNEHuAKQGqNvBVxED2H2
transaction
50e4784cec3601941905432a4d00e68b5d7dfce8e00321575ea40c87b8360caf
spent
true